Task requirements

Domestic Considerations: Stable locaiton, opportunity to travel to MOD MB and wider FVEYs for professional courses. Flexible working options available.
Position Role: 2IC of one of Defence's regionally or thematically aligned IRMCM teams. Acting as conduit for intelligence requirements between analysts and collectors across Defence.
Responsibilities:
1. Provide support to TL, conduct CL&M of RFI, IRM, CM activity and team personnel IOT deliver IRMCM outputs for UK Defence. 
2. Support DI Ops and DI SROs understanding and management of critical intelligence gaps and risks, through engagement with DI Mission Managers.
3. Through DI customer engagement, refine Intelligence Requirements in line with the Defence Strategic Intelligence Prioritisation Process (DSIPP).
4. Support the generation of collection strategies or CONOPS in line with the DSIPP, events or crisis.
5. Monitor the impact of IRMCM activity against prioritised intelligence gaps to support development of MOE and MOP.
6. Deliver IRMCM SME and D&G on behalf of DI Ops to stakeholders, WGs and visitors. Engage with PAG, Int’l Allies on behalf of JIOC.  
7. Provide DI and pan-Defence training and coaching of IRMCM processes to include continuous development and implementation of best practice
8. Take a proactive CL&M role in intelligence CPD, wider defence, organisation or operational staff work activities, IOT contribute to Command output.
